What each input means
- Finished weight (lbs)
- Estimated weight of the finished bronze sculpture in pounds.
- Bronze alloy
- 0 = Silicon Bronze ($7.50/lb), 1 = Manganese Bronze ($5.50/lb), 2 = Aluminum Bronze ($8.50/lb).
- Complexity (1-3)
- 1 = simple solid form, 2 = moderate detail/undercuts, 3 = highly complex with fine detail.
- Edition size
- Number of castings in the edition. Mold cost is amortized across editions.
- Sculpture height (in)
- Overall height of the sculpture in inches.
What each result means
- Foundry cost per casting
- Total foundry cost per casting including materials, labor, energy, and markup.
- Raw metal cost
- Cost of bronze alloy including pour waste (sprues, gates).
- Total materials
- Metal, wax, and ceramic shell materials combined.
- Foundry labor
- Chasing, welding seams, sandblasting, and grinding labor.
- Labor hours
- Estimated foundry labor hours for chasing and finishing.
- Mold cost per cast
- Rubber mold cost amortized over the edition size.
- Kiln/furnace energy
- Energy cost for wax burnout and metal melting.
- Total edition cost
- Foundry cost for the entire edition.
- Retail price (low)
- Suggested retail at 3x foundry cost.
- Retail price (high)
- Suggested retail at 5x foundry cost.
